#197b80 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#197b80 is composed of 9.8% red, 48.2%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.5% cyan, 3.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 182.9 degrees, a saturation of 67.3% and a lightness of 30%. #197b80 color hex could be obtained by blending #32f6ff with #000001.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#197b80 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#197b80 has RGB values of R:25, G:123,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0.04, Y:0,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 1670016.

Shades and Tints of #197b80
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030d0d is the darkest color, while #fcf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#197b80
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#485051 is the less saturated color, while #019098 is the most saturated one.
